The work of art by architect and sculptor Franz Josef Krings, which was created in 1933 to mark the 50th anniversary of Richard Wagner's death, had lost its head.
Strotmann & Partner began with the restoration.
After cleaning, a new metal framework will be created inside. The head, which weighs around 150 kilograms, will then be firmly attached to the body with the help of this inner framework.
